Dashlets
Dashlets are customizable, context-sensitive areas which can be integrated into enaio® client. The contents of dashlets are predefined by the administrator and cannot be changed by users. They allow you to incorporate information sources, such as Wikipedia or Google Maps, but also web applications, such as the enaio® office-365-dashlet or the coLab dashlet. Up to ten additional dashlets can be added in enaio® client.
An additional button will be added in the View ribbon tab in the Areas ribbon group for every integrated dashlet.
Reset the window layout of enaio® client (ENAIO ribbon tab > Settings > Workspace) before you can show/hide a newly configured dashlet.
The following dashlets will be described in this documentation:
-
coLab dashlet
Establishes a direct connection between a selected coLab object (folder, register, or document) in enaio® client and enaio® coLab (see coLab dashlet).
-
enaio® kairos dashlet
Used for AI-powered, automatic classification and indexing of documents (see enaio® kairos).
-
enaio® office-365-dashlet
Enables collaborative editing of Microsoft Office documents (see enaio® office-365-dashlet).
